Olá pessoal!

Estou em dúvida como testar se um campo é vazio.

quero fazer um select onde apenas os registros que não tenham sido pagos
sejam selecionados. Mais ou menos isso:

SELECT sum(valor) FROM venda WHERE data_vencimento = 'vazio'.

Queria também selecionar outros campos além dessa soma,

SELECT sum(valor), num_parcela FROM venda WHERE venda.id_venda = 10

porém qdo coloco outro campo, dá a seguinte mensagem:

ERROR:  column "venda.num_parcela" must appear in the GROUP BY clause or be
used in an aggregate function

Se alguém puder me ajudar...

Obrigada!

--
---------------------------
Márcia Regina
_______________________________________________
Grupo de Usuários do PostgreSQL no Brasil
Antes de perguntar consulte o manual
http://pgdocptbr.sourceforge.net/

Para editar suas opções ou sair da lista acesse a página da lista em:
http://pgfoundry.org/mailman/listinfo/brasil-usuarios

Responder a